Whewboy! What a weekend! Yesterday, was Bridgy's very first time in a show, and she did well! We are so proud of our baby girl! She was at the Okeechobee, FL show, being shown for us by Roger & Dale of Showtime Training Center, under 3 Judges. Yesterday, was her AMHR Classes. Roger took her in for her very first "Show Debut" in Halter - Sr. Mare 30" & Under, where she placed unanimously by all 3 judges as 3rd Place (out of a class of 4). She was so very nervous, highly alert to every sound and movement in the arena all around her. Roger tried to help her settle where he could set her up for the judges, but she was just too nervous to pay attention. She did try though, and he was able to finally get her to stand square and up....only, it was after the judges had already made their choices, LOL. Oh well, we think she did great for her very first time EVER in a show ring. :)

Her second class, she did much better. Roger took are again, in the Multi-Color Mare "A-34" & Under". Under 3 judges, she placed one 1st Place, one 2nd Place, and one 3rd Place, (out of a class of 4). Yayyy!!! :)

Her last class, was a DOOZY!!! With over 20 entries in this class, she went in for her turn third from last. She sure tried her honest to goodness hardest though. She was still very nervous, unsure of what to expect, all the sounds, the music, people and horses everywhere, yet she sure was a sight of pure beauty out there....at least to "me" she was, LOL! Sadly, she did not place in this class, but she was a WINNER in my heart anyways!
